People are overvaluing the QB situation this year.

Stafford was traded for a 1st (2022 1st)and 3rd. The other 1st (2023)is for the Lions to take Goff.

Wentz was traded for essentially 2 2nd round picks.

To get the no 2 pick. The Bears give up either 3 1sts or 2 1sts and 2 2nds. If Pace believes in Wilson and Nagy, he has to go for it. If Wilson produces, great. If not, Bears won’t be competitive for next 5 years.

if I were pace, I would say fuck it and go for gold. Go down swinging instead of looking at 3rd strike.

The trade chart says three firsts and a later round pick to move up from #20 to #2. I don't know that I like Wilson or Fields enough for that. I would give that up for Watson or Russ, but I don't see any non-Lawrence QB as a sure thing. They all have a decent bust potential - and if they bust after giving that up its's a franchise wrecker - and even still could take a couple years to develop without first round picks to help.

I also wouldn't be mad if they take a big swing, but I may wait to see if one falls and move up then. All depends on their evaluations.

He's only Rick Mirer if the Bears trade their first round draft choice for him.
I completely get your point, but Mirer was always a dumb trade. The year prior to the Bears getting him he had like 5 TD's and 12 picks in 11 games. The year before that he had 13 TD's and 20 picks. While having a completion percentage around 52 percent. Those were also his 3rd and 4th years in the league. The Bears are snakebit at the QB position but Mirer was awful when we got him. We traded a high first round pick for Todd Collins.
